Best forShipStation is purpose-built for product-based small businesses shipping physical goods through multiple online channels. It delivers the most value to Shopify or WooCommerce store owners who also sell on marketplaces like Amazon, Etsy, or Walmart and are tired of logging into each separately to process orders. Small brands shipping 50 to 10,000 orders per month see the clearest ROI—enough volume to recover the subscription cost through carrier discounts and time savings. Apparel brands, gift sellers, subscription box operators, and handmade goods businesses with seasonal spikes all benefit from the automation rules that prevent fulfillment bottlenecks. Small 3PLs and fulfillment houses managing orders on behalf of multiple clients can also use ShipStation's multi-seller features, though larger operations may eventually outgrow it.SMSBump via Yotpo is best suited to direct-to-consumer Shopify brands with an established customer base—typically stores doing consistent monthly orders who want to convert one-time buyers into loyal repeat purchasers. Apparel, beauty, health and wellness, and specialty food brands tend to see the strongest ROI because their customers respond well to SMS and have clear repurchase cycles. Marketing coordinators and solo marketing leads at shops with 2–50 employees will get the most out of the platform, particularly if reviews and loyalty programs are already on the roadmap. It also fits well for brands running paid social ads who want to close the loop by syndicating reviews and UGC directly into their ad creative pipeline.

ShipStation

ShipStation centralizes order fulfillment across every sales channel and unlocks carrier discounts up to 90% that most small businesses can't negotiate alone.

Key features

  • Discounted carrier rates up to 90% off retail on major carriers
  • Automation rules select rates and print labels without manual order review
  • Connects to 100-plus selling channels including Shopify, Amazon, and Etsy
  • Bulk label printing and scan-to-verify packing for warehouse accuracy
  • Branded tracking pages and automated customer shipment notifications
  • Self-service returns portal reduces inbound customer service requests
  • Multi-warehouse and inventory location support for growing operations
  • Reporting dashboard tracks shipping costs, carrier performance, and volume trends

Limitations

Pricing is tiered by monthly shipment volume, and the entry-level plan caps you at 50 shipments per month—fine for very early-stage sellers but limiting once you grow. Costs can escalate meaningfully as volume increases, so budgeting requires tracking your monthly ship count. The interface, while functional, has a learning curve for automation rule logic; new users often need a few hours to understand rule hierarchy and avoid conflicts. International shipping workflows, while supported, require additional attention to customs documentation and duties that newer users sometimes underestimate. Customer support response times have drawn mixed reviews; phone support availability depends on your plan tier. Verify current plan details and support access on the vendor site.

SMSBump

Turn one-time buyers into repeat customers using SMS, loyalty programs, and reviews inside a single Shopify-native platform.

Key features

  • Automated SMS and MMS flows triggered by cart abandonment, purchase, and browse behavior
  • Integrated review collection with automatic distribution to Google and social channels
  • Loyalty and referral program builder with customizable point and reward tiers
  • AI-assisted content tools to amplify user-generated content in paid advertising
  • Shopify-native installation with pre-built campaign templates for rapid deployment
  • Segmentation engine targeting subscribers by purchase history, spend, and engagement
  • Two-way SMS conversations enabling customer replies and support handoffs to Gorgias
  • 180+ integrations including Klaviyo, Facebook, Google, and major Shopify apps

Limitations

The platform's depth is genuinely Shopify-first—merchants on BigCommerce, WooCommerce, or custom storefronts will find integration options limited or incomplete, so verify compatibility before purchasing. Pricing scales with list size and active features, which can make costs climb quickly for fast-growing brands; SMS credits are typically billed separately from platform fees, so budget planning requires attention. Teams expecting a lightweight, plug-and-play SMS tool may find the full Yotpo interface more complex than needed. SMS compliance requirements (TCPA in the US, GDPR in Europe) add an onboarding step that first-time SMS marketers sometimes underestimate. Customer support quality at lower plan tiers has received mixed reviews—verify SLA commitments before signing.
